What companies run services between Brisbane Airport (BNE), Australia and Melbourne, VIC, Australia?

Jetstar, Qantas, and Virgin Australia fly from Brisbane Airport (BNE) to Melbourne Airport (MEL) hourly. Alternatively, you can take a train from International Airport Station to Southern Cross via Roma Street, Roma Street Station, and Central Station in around 27h 39m.
